#866166 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#866166 is composed of 52.5% red, 38%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.6% magenta, 23.9%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 351.9 degrees, a saturation of 16% and a lightness of 45.3%. #866166 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2cc with #0d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#866166 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.
#866166 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#866166 has RGB values of R:134, G:97,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.24,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8806758.

Shades and Tints of #866166
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090607 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#866166
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747373 is the less saturated color, while #df0825 is the most saturated one.
